Quick Start

pg_dump - Text Format:

# Simple full backup
pg_dump -h localhost -U postgres -F p database_name > backup.sql

# With compression
pg_dump -h localhost -U postgres -F p database_name | gzip > backup.sql.gz

# Backup with verbose output
pg_dump -h localhost -U postgres -F p -v database_name > backup.sql 2>&1

# Exclude specific tables
pg_dump -h localhost -U postgres database_name \
  --exclude-table=temp_* --exclude-table=logs > backup.sql
